			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>It was a <del datetime="00">boring</del> match until the last 4 minutes of stoppage time, which saw a questionable penalty given to <a href="http://www.uefa.com/footballeurope/club=7889/competition=1/index.html">Liverpool</a> (Fine by me, we&#8217;ll take the draw) and 4 yellow cards.</p>
<p>If we hadn&#8217;t scored, I would probably started off by saying Liverpool was shite. <a href="http://www.uefa.com/footballeurope/club=50124/competition=1/index.html">Nando&#8217;s former club</a> outplayed us, and though we had most of the possessions in the 2nd half, we were not able to find the net. And this, despite 2nd-choice goalkeeper, Leo Franco, spilling the ball on several occasions.</p>
<p><strong>Robbie Keane</strong> proved once again he is pretty much ineffective as a lone striker and has not yet tuned in to the same frequency as the rest of the squad. Even the commentator mentioned that he &#8220;tries too hard&#8221;.</p>
<p>The 1st half was mostly played in the midfield, both teams giving away the ball recklessly. We had several close calls, as early as the 1st minute into the game, and on the 15th, when <strong>Xabi Alonso</strong>&#8217;s long cross to <strong>Keane </strong>was met by a volley which then miss the back of the net.</p>
<p>Atletico had their chances too in the 1st half, when Simao was unmarked in front of <strong>Reina</strong>, but ballooned the ball way off the post. It was captain Maxi Rodriquez who converted for the Spanish team in the 37th minute, after a sublime pass from Antonio Lopez on the right wing.</p>
<p>There was a couple of hand ball claims in the 2nd half. Ref Hansson just couldn&#8217;t give 2.5 shites about them. Dejected <strong>Rafa Benitez</strong> seemed to be running out of options when he surprisingly called upon the services of <strong>David N&#8217;gog</strong>, whom I might add, looked more at ease in his striker role, than the Irishman.</p>
<p>Man of the match for me would have to be <strong>Steven Gerrard</strong>, if not <strong>Daniel Agger</strong>. Despite losing steam in the later part of the 2nd half, he kept pressing on and had several  good shots on goal, notably one on the 70th minute after a link-up with <strong>Keane</strong>. Captain Fantastic once again saved the game for us : ))</p>
<p>Interestingly enough, Liverpool has not won against a Spanish club from their past 5 encounters in Anfield, so this is kinda, sorta a good draw for the Reds. LFC just needs one more victory to qualify into the knockout rounds.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img src="http://liverpool.theoffside.com/files/2008/07/davidngog_1055145-300x225.jpg" alt="" width="300" height="225" class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-818" /> Well you can add another name to the Liverpool squad for the upcoming season. The club announced today that French sensation David Ngog will be plying his trade at Anfield after making the move from PSG. While I don&#8217;t know much about Ngog, everything that I&#8217;ve read and seen has got me pretty excited. He&#8217;s only 19-years-old, so he still has a lot of growing to do. But if his two goal performance against England last season for the French U-19&#8217;s was any indication of what we might see this year, then I&#8217;m all for giving him a shot. </p>
<p>Like most, I trust Rafa and his judgment completely. While I&#8217;m fairly certain you&#8217;ll see him playing with the reserves next year, I&#8217;m glad to see that the goateed-one will give him a chance to shine before letting him get acclimated to the English game with the second team.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s also worth noting that he&#8217;s the cousin of former Newcastle United defender Jean-Alain Boumsong, so that&#8217;s a bit of interesting news since Boumsong was almost a done and dusted member of the club before he made his move to Rangers on a free transfer.</p>
